Expression and subcellular localization of syntaxin 11 in human neutrophils
Li-Xin Xie1, Janis de la Iglesia-Vicente, Yun-Xiang Fang
1Department of Pharmacology, School of Pharmaceutical Science, Central South University, 410078 Changsha, China.
Human neutrophils express syntaxin 11, a protein linked to familial hemophagocytic lymphohistiocytosis (FHL). This finding suggests neutrophils may play a role in FHL pathology.

Background:
- Familial hemophagocytic lymphohistiocytosis (FHL) is a severe hyperinflammatory syndrome.
- Syntaxin 11 mutations are a known cause of FHL.
- Neutrophils are key inflammatory cells.
Purpose of the Study:
- To investigate the expression and subcellular localization of syntaxin 11 in human neutrophils.
- To understand the role of neutrophils in FHL.
Main Methods:
- Utilized human peripheral blood neutrophils and HL-60 cells.
- Employed RT-PCR, Western blot, immunocytochemistry, and subcellular fractionation.
- Induced neutrophil differentiation in HL-60 cells.
Main Results:
- Syntaxin 11 mRNA and protein are expressed in human neutrophils.
- Syntaxin 11 expression increased during HL-60 cell differentiation.
- Syntaxin 11 is a membrane protein, primarily located in azurophilic granules, translocating to the plasma membrane upon activation.
Conclusions:
- Human neutrophils express syntaxin 11.
- Neutrophils may be involved in the pathology of familial hemophagocytic lymphohistiocytosis.
